As nouns, antihistamine is a hypernym of cyproheptadine; that is, antihistamine is a word with a broader meaning than cyproheptadine:
  • cyproheptadine: an antihistamine (trade name Periactin) used to treat some allergic reactions
  • antihistamine: a medicine used to treat allergies and hypersensitive reactions and colds; works by counteracting the effects of histamine on a receptor site
